Lessons for outsourcing

How can local authorities adopt a proactive approach to outsourcing children’s services? Simone Vibert explains the importance of strong relationships and planning

In our report, commissioning children's services – what works? Demos makes a series of recommendations aimed at maximising the benefits of outsourcing, three of which are targeted at local authorities.

Two of the recommendations are easy to understand – although not as straightforward to implement. They urge local authorities to prioritise data collection, and to facilitate community-led exercises in which local stakeholders define desired outcomes for looked-after children and children with special educational needs and disabilities in the area.
